欢迎光临百泉姚正网络有限公司司官网!
全国咨询热线:13301113604
当前位置: 首页 > 新闻动态

Go语言:理解结构体中数组与切片的正确用法

时间:2025-12-01 07:14:52

Go语言:理解结构体中数组与切片的正确用法
可以通过在创建数组时指定order='F'参数来启用Fortran顺序。
""" cache: dict[str, str] # 定义并注解了函数属性 'cache' _call: typing.Callable[[str], None] # 定义并注解了被包装函数的类型 def __init__(self, call: typing.Callable[[str], None]) -> None: """ 初始化Cacheable实例。
在极端情况下,可以考虑分批处理或直接使用数据库查询进行聚合,以优化性能。
它不需要使用def关键字,语法紧凑,常用于需要函数对象的场合。
// #cgo darwin LDFLAGS: -lodbc: 指定链接ODBC库。
接下来是 char c 占用1字节。
本文旨在详细探讨如何在已排序的整数列表中高效地查找小于或等于给定目标值的最大元素。
对于C S1,由于没有'ts',ts列显示为NaN;同理,D S2的td列也显示为NaN。
Go语言通过标准库encoding/csv提供了对CSV文件的读写支持,使用简单且高效。
所有权语义不同 unique_ptr 实现独占式所有权。
测试框架通过逐步增加调用量来稳定结果,最终输出每操作耗时、内存分配等指标。
本文探讨了在 Go 语言中可靠地删除 Unix 域套接字链接的最佳实践。
立即学习“Python免费学习笔记(深入)”; 问题根源分析:字符串拼接而非类型转换 造成上述问题的原因通常是代码在处理从文件读取的原始字符串时,错误地通过字符串拼接操作来“构造”看起来像元组的字符串,而不是执行实际的类型转换。
访问weak_ptr对象需调用lock()获取shared_ptr,确保对象仍存活。
答案:PHP通过time()和date()处理基础日期时间,strtotime()转换日期字符串为时间戳,DateTime类实现面向对象的时间操作,支持格式化、时区设置与时间差计算,结合DateInterval可精确获取时间间隔,合理使用这些工具能高效完成注册时间记录、超时判断等常见需求。
data: 这是一个函数,允许我们在每次 AJAX 请求之前修改要发送的数据。
它将 yield 语句之前的代码作为 __enter__ 的逻辑,yield 语句之后(直到函数结束或返回)的代码作为 __exit__ 的逻辑。
示例代码: package main import ( "bufio" "fmt" "net" "strings" ) func main() { // 监听本地8080端口 listener, err := net.Listen("tcp", ":8080") if err != nil { fmt.Println("监听失败:", err) return } defer listener.Close() fmt.Println("服务器已启动,监听 :8080...") for { // 接受客户端连接 conn, err := listener.Accept() if err != nil { fmt.Println("接受连接失败:", err) continue } // 启动协程处理连接 go handleConnection(conn) } } func handleConnection(conn net.Conn) { defer conn.Close() scanner := bufio.NewScanner(conn) for scanner.Scan() { message := strings.TrimSpace(scanner.Text()) fmt.Printf("收到消息: %s\n", message) // 回显消息给客户端 response := fmt.Sprintf("你发送的是: %s\n", message) conn.Write([]byte(response)) } } 创建TCP客户端 客户端通过net.Dial连接到服务器,然后可以发送数据并读取响应。
$largeArray = range(0, 100000); // 假设一个大数组 for ($i = 0; $i < count($largeArray); $i++) { // 每次迭代都调用 count() // ... do something }count() 函数虽然很快,但在一个百万次循环中被调用百万次,累积起来的开销就不容忽视了。
理解Go语言中的通道缓冲区 Go语言中的通道(channel)是实现并发通信和同步的关键原语。

本文链接:http://www.jnmotorsbikes.com/722617_58570.html